Project description
Boosting sustainable microalgae-derived products use at scale
Microalgae are unicellular photosynthetic organisms encountered in aquatic environments such as oceans, lakes and rivers. Emerging evidence indicates that apart from their role in ecosystems, they can be harnessed as a sustainable source of ingredients for food, cosmetics and other industrial applications. Despite their potential, utilisation of microalgae in Europe remains limited, primarily due to high production costs and the absence of scalable processing technologies. To address this issue, the EU-funded MULTIPLY project proposes to develop environmentally friendly and economically viable methods for cultivating and processing microalgae. By exploring different production and extraction methods for different microalgae and using digital tools and circular approaches, the consortium hopes to pave the way for competitive and sustainable microalgae for different industry fields in Europe.
Objective
Microalgae biomass holds a great potential to become the reference source of sustainable ingredients for a broad range of bio-based industries. However, it is still an underexploited feedstock in Europe, mostly used to produce low volume/high value products, due to lack of cost-competitive technological solutions for cultivation and biorefinery processes. MULTIPLY aims to demonstrate economically feasible and environmentally sustainable microalgae cultivation and biorefinery processes, for the provision of valuable algal ingredients, suited for the formulation of mid-price products for the food, feed, biomaterials, lubricants and cosmetics sectors. By enhancing and upscaling efficient, innovative and green technologies for the main steps of microalgae cultivation and downstream processing, implementing circular economy approaches and incorporating advanced monitoring and digital tools, MULTIPLY will increase productivity, reduce the use of resources and associated costs and improve the environmental performance of the processes. Based on 5 microalgae species, MULTIPLY will deliver 10 products of improved environmental impact, meeting market requirements. Led by the industry and backed up on institutes and universities of excellence, MULTIPLY brings together microalgae primary producers from southern and northern Europe, technology developers, researchers and industrial end-users of algae ingredients. A strong dissemination, communication and exploitation strategy will ensure an effective uptake of the project results, enabled by a better understanding of the social acceptance drivers and stimulating the enhanced public acceptance for algae-based products and processes. MULTIPLY will create new value chains, paving the way for the deployment of a sustainable, circular and digital microalgae industry in Europe.
